Our bursary, offering up to 100% off school fees, is open for applications

Posted: 16th January 2023

This bursary is a fantastic  opportunity for local children who embody the ethos and values of the school, but who, for financial reasons, would not normally be able to attend St Christopher’s.

The bursary is in memory of Gregory Kenyon who established St Christopher’s as a Nursery School in 1991 with his wife Jane. 

We are looking for someone who shows excellence in a particular area of the curriculum, whether that be academic, creative or sporting. We also want parents to be fully immersed in school life, supporting the school and its community and be willing to become a member of the Friends of St Christopher’s.
